TLT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

697 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F (TLT)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$14.9B — down 8.5% from $16.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 156 funds opened new TLT positions and 107 closed out — a net gain of 49 holders — while 240 added to existing stakes and 230 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Moore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$471M. The largest seller was Barclays, cutting an estimated $463M.
